This well-presented three-bedroom detached house offers a comfortable and practical family home on a desirable corner plot. The property opens into a welcoming hallway leading to a spacious bay-fronted living room, providing a versatile space for everyday living and entertaining. The open-plan kitchen and dining area is fitted with modern units and offers ample space for family meals. A utility room and ground-floor WC add to the home’s practicality.
Upstairs, the main bedroom benefits from a private ensuite, while two further bedrooms are served by a contemporary main bathroom. The property is currently leasehold, with the freehold in the process of being purchased, and is offered with no onward chain. Council Tax Band C applies. Solar panels, owned outright by the vendor, provide energy savings and support sustainable living.
Externally, the house features a generous enclosed rear garden, mainly laid to lawn with a patio, offering privacy and space for children or outdoor entertaining. The corner plot provides additional side space for potential landscaping or storage, subject to permissions. A private driveway to the front accommodates multiple vehicles. This modern, energy-efficient home combines practical living with excellent outside space in a sought-after residential location.
